2 arrested with infrared cameras at LAX
Yahoo ^ | 4/05/2008 | n/a

Posted on 04/05/2008 4:47:14 PM PDT by DemforBush

LOS ANGELES - Two men attempting to board a plane to China with nearly a dozen sensitive infrared cameras in their luggage were arrested on Saturday, a federal official said...
